To disable ClassicLink DNS support for a VPC
This example disables ClassicLink DNS support for
vpc-88888888
.Command:
aws ec2 disable-vpc-classic-link-dns-support --vpc-id
vpc-88888888
Output:
{ "Return": true }

Example 1: This example disables ClassicLink DNS support for the vpc-0b12d3456a7e8910d
Disable-EC2VpcClassicLinkDnsSupport -VpcId vpc-0b12d3456a7e8910d
